Boss Loot & Drop Announcements

Killing a boss pays out everything to the summoner — the player whose key opened the portal. The haul is the same whether you fought solo or brought a full party, so summoning is the privilege and the loot is yours alone. If the summoner is offline when the boss dies, their drops wait safely in /stash.

Party size never changes the table. Bringing friends helps you survive the fight, but it doesn't split or multiply the rewards — only the summoner is paid.

Network-wide drop announcements

Land a Legendary or Mythic drop and the whole network finds out. Every player sees a chat banner naming you and the item, while lightning strikes and fireworks burst where you're standing. Mythic drops add a dragon-roar on top.

There's no server-wide title pop — that was removed. Mythic stays as the chat banner plus the roar.

Exceptional orbs

Every boss drops a signature exceptional enchant orb. The maximum level its enchant can reach:

  • Lamia: Efficiency 6
  • Echidna: Momentum 6
  • Thanatos: Lucky 4
  • Hephaestus: Powerball 4

Exceptional orbs don't apply for free: by default they have a 50% success rate, and each one must be charged with Ancient Energy before it can be applied at all. A failed application is consumed, so it's worth lining up the application before you spend one.

Every Uber boss drops an exceptional orb of its own, one per boss, on top of the four above.

Browsing a table in /loot

Every boss table is browsable in /loot, and each entry now renders as the real item it drops instead of a nameless placeholder — Gravecall, flares, sigils and lootboxes included. Boss tables are discovery-gated, so a drop you haven't pulled yet stays hidden until you land it once. The Uber tables appear the same way, each row carrying that boss's own summoning-key art.
